Israel - Total Access to Computers from Home
Since 2014, Israel Total Access to Computers from Home was down by 0.4points year on year. At 79.5 Percent of Households in 2019, the country was number 23 among other countries in Total Access to Computers from Home. Israel is overtaken by Spain, which was ranked number 22 with 80.63 Percent of Households and is followed by Lithuania at 75.88 Percent of Households. Netherlands lead the ranking with 99.2 Percent of Households in 2019, +0.8points compared to 2018. Luxembourg, Iceland and Norway resp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Mexico recorded the best 5 years average growth at +3points per year, while Brazil witnessed the worst performance at -4.8points per year.
